Eavestrough Clearing in Frederick, MD

Eavestrough clearing services involve the removal of debris such as leaves, twigs, and dirt from the gutters and downspouts of residential properties. This process helps ensure that rainwater flows freely away from the foundation, preventing potential water damage, basement flooding, and issues with landscape erosion. Projects typically include cleaning gutters on single-family homes, multi-unit buildings, and other structures, often as part of seasonal maintenance or pre-winter preparations. Property owners usually want to understand the scope of cleaning, the safety measures involved, and whether the service includes inspecting for damage or leaks that may require repairs.

Before requesting eavestrough clearing, homeowners should consider the size and height of their property, the accessibility of gutters, and any specific concerns about blockages or damage. It’s helpful to know if the service includes a thorough inspection of the entire gutter system and whether additional repairs or maintenance might be recommended afterward. Properly maintained eavestroughs contribute to the overall health of a property’s exterior, making regular cleaning an important aspect of property upkeep.

Eavestrough Clearing Questions

What is eavestrough clearing? Eavestrough clearing involves removing leaves, debris, and obstructions from gutters to ensure proper water flow away from the property.

Why is regular eavestrough cleaning important? Regular cleaning helps prevent water damage, foundation issues, and basement flooding by maintaining effective drainage.

What types of debris are typically removed during cleaning? Common debris includes leaves, twigs, dirt, and small branches that can clog gutters and downspouts.

How can clogged eavestroughs affect a property? Clogged gutters can cause water overflow, leading to roof damage, siding deterioration, and potential structural problems.
